Industry Trends
Global 5-chloromethyl furfural market is projected to be driven by growing demand for paraxylene, and purified terephthalic acid (PTA) as precursors for polyethylene terephthalate production. Currently, 5-chloromethyl furfural is gaining traction in biorefinery industry as versatile bio-platform molecule and an efficient alternative to 5-(hydroxymethyl) furfural (HMF). As 5-chloromethyl furfural can be produced in high yields compared to 5-(hydroxymethyl) furfural, the product has emerged as a disruptive innovation in biorefinery sector. However, the 5-chloromethyl furfural application in biorefinery sector is still in nascent phase and is projected to bode well in overall growth of bio-platform chemical markets in near future. Moreover, the product is being widely used in various chemistries which includes production of paraxylene, purified terephthalic acid (PTA), polyethylene terephthalate (PET), furandicarboxylic acid (FDCA), etc. Among these chemicals, high consumption of polyethylene terephthalate (PET) for food and non-food packaging applications amid COVID-19 pandemic emerged as the major driver for 5-chloromethyl furfural market growth in 2020. This growth was attributed to upsurge in demand for sanitizer bottles and e-commerce packaging. Also, consumer notion towards reducing virus exposure by using single use plastic (SUPs) products such as plastic bags, containers, bottles, lids, straws, etc. highly contributed in driving the production of polyethylene terephthalate (PET) which subsequently increased the demand for 5-chloromethyl furfural market in 2020.
Growing trend of decarbonization has positively influenced the product demand, as various industry participants are involved in developing carbon neutral products. For instance, Origin Materials is actively engaged in development of 5-chloromethyl furfural from C5 sugars, which is intended to reduce carbon emissions. Following such scenario, the company published lifecycle assessment report which claims that each kilogram of 5-chloromethyl furfural has effect of removing 1.21 kilogram of CO2 from the environment. In addition, successive R&D activities to develop carbon negative polyethylene terephthalate bottles have been sought by various industry participants which are inclined towards decarbonizing ecosystem. Thus, increasing product demand as an efficient carbon mitigating option along with growing number of decarbonizing directives across the globe is projected to foster 5-chloromethyl furfural market growth in the foreseeable future.
The industry was negatively impacted for short term during the COVID-19 pandemic. Supply chain disruption causing shortage of labour and feedstock influenced the demand for 5-chloromethyl furfural market. Brief repositioning of industry participants engaged in production of bio-platform based products including 5-chloromethyl furfural generated demand uncertainty by suspending production activities for short term. However, increasing demand for food packaging along with growth in e-commerce amid pandemic stabilized the product demand which subsequently drove 5-chloromethyl furfural market growth at a steady pace in 2020.

Purity Outlook:
Based on the purity, 5-chloromethyl furfural market has been segmented into 95%, 96%, 98% and others. 98% and below product purity level to dominate the 5-chloromethyl furfural market in 2020. The growth in this segment can be attributed to competitive prices along with abundant product availability with such purity. Also, production routes and yields of 5-chloromethyl furfural are projected to play a major role in driving product penetration in terms of purity. As the production route was earlier based on fructose and sucrose, manufacturer’s inclination towards high yields led to high penetration of such product purity. Low prices of feedstock along with conventional production routes led for the segment growth in 2020. However, growing product innovation concurrent to transition toward bio-based routes have increased incorporation of raw materials such as cellulose, bamboo pulp and other wood-based sources. Advancements in bio-based routes along with incorporation of the aforementioned raw materials is projected to drive high purity 5-chloromethyl furfural >98% in the extended run.
